返回

构建小程序的喜怒哀乐:从欢声笑语到心力交瘁

前端

从“无所畏惧”到“如履薄冰”:小程序开发的心路历程

怀着满腔热情和一颗乐于探索的心,我踏上了小程序开发的征程。初次涉猎,我对一切事物都感到好奇, eager to learn and explore 渴望学习和探索, 并为能够创造出实用的应用程序而感到兴奋。随着项目的深入,我逐渐意识到小程序开发并不像我想象的那么简单。

初学者往往会遇到各种各样的问题和挑战,例如:

  • 理解小程序框架和开发工具: 小程序开发框架通常与传统Web开发框架不同,因此需要一定的时间来适应和学习。
  • 调试和错误修复: 小程序开发中会出现各种各样的错误和问题,需要耐心和细致地进行调试和修复。
  • 性能优化: 小程序的性能优化是一项复杂且艰巨的任务,需要深入了解小程序的运行机制和优化技巧。
  • 兼容性问题: 小程序需要在不同的设备和平台上运行,因此需要考虑兼容性问题,确保应用程序能够在所有支持的设备上正常运行。

这些问题和挑战有时会让人感到沮丧和挫败,但也是成长和学习的机会。通过不断地学习、实践和总结,我逐渐掌握了小程序开发的技巧和方法,并能够更加自信地应对各种挑战。

小程序开发的“欢声笑语”:收获的喜悦

在小程序开发过程中,也经历了许多欢声笑语和收获的喜悦。

  • 成功发布小程序: 将自己开发的小程序成功发布到应用商店或其他平台时,总是感到无比自豪和兴奋。
  • 用户的好评和反馈: 收到用户的正面评价和反馈,是对我工作最大的肯定和激励。
  • 解决难题的成就感: 当我成功地解决了一个难题或完成了一个复杂的功能时,总是感到无比的成就感和满足感。
  • 与团队合作的乐趣: 与其他开发人员一起合作开发小程序,可以碰撞出新的想法和灵感,也能够互相学习和成长。

这些欢声笑语和收获的喜悦,让我对小程序开发产生了更深厚的热爱和兴趣,也更加坚定了我在这个领域继续探索和发展的决心。

小程序开发的“心力交瘁”:挑战与磨砺

在小程序开发过程中,也经历了许多心力交瘁和挑战的时刻。

  • 长时间的加班和熬夜: 为了赶项目进度或解决紧急问题,经常需要长时间加班和熬夜,身心俱疲。
  • 与客户或其他团队的沟通不畅: 有时与客户或其他团队的沟通不畅,会导致项目进展缓慢或出现分歧,令人感到沮丧。
  • 项目失败或延期: 有时由于各种原因,项目可能会失败或延期,这会带来巨大的压力和挫败感。
  • 职业倦怠: 持续高强度的开发工作可能会导致职业倦怠,失去对开发的热情和动力。

这些心力交瘁和挑战的时刻,让我深刻地认识到小程序开发的艰辛和不易。但我也从中吸取了宝贵的经验和教训,让我更加坚韧和成熟。

小程序开发的“常用功能”:分享与总结

在小程序开发过程中,积累了一些常用的功能和技巧,希望与大家分享和总结:

  • 网络请求和数据处理: 小程序开发中经常需要与服务器进行网络请求和数据处理,可以使用小程序提供的API来实现。
  • 本地存储和缓存: 小程序开发中可以使用小程序提供的本地存储和缓存功能来提高应用程序的性能和用户体验。
  • 事件监听和处理: 小程序开发中可以使用小程序提供的事件监听和处理机制来响应用户操作和应用程序状态的变化。
  • 组件和模板: 小程序开发中可以使用小程序提供的组件和模板来构建应用程序的用户界面,提高开发效率。
  • 调试和错误修复: 小程序开发中可以使用小程序提供的调试工具和错误信息来帮助查找和修复错误。

这些常用的功能和技巧,可以帮助小程序开发者提高开发效率和应用程序质量。

结语

小程序开发是一段充满喜怒哀乐的旅程。从初尝欢声笑语的喜悦,到历经心力交瘁的磨砺,我逐渐成长和成熟,也对小程序开发有了更深厚的热爱和兴趣。希望我的分享和总结,能够为大家带来帮助和启发,也希望更多的人能够加入小程序开发的大军,共同创造出更多实用的应用程序。